Re: 1-13 at the DW : Thu Sep 12, 2019 4:36 pm  
warrior1872 wrote:
Why should i have to justify my choice to the likes of you i don't know I'm not sure why people are choosing tomkins over radlinski why not pick up on that one


I think hes just asking the question pal, no ulterior motives.
I suppose the thread is subjective as it says favourite players, not best etc.
On our WhatsApp group I picked Richard's and Dallas over Robinson, mainly because they both played 6/7/8 seasons at the DW whereas robinson only one.
I wouldn't for a second say either were better than Robinson.
I picked carmont and gildart over Connolly and renouf, mainly because they've won more and played far more at the DW so more than likely going to have given me more moments. Neither of them match Connolly & Renouf over their whole careers
I debated Mickey Mac over Newton as hes won more, but I just went for Newton as he did play a lot of games and I remember more "Highlights".
As I say "All subjective" and my guess is that the reply was because the poster thinks that newton/barrett/Faz were better players (which i would agree with), but that want the question so everyone is entitled to their own favourites.
WhatsApp post below.

My team
Going slightly a different way and looking at how long they played and consistency

Tomkins
Dallas
Gildart
Carmont
Richards
Barrett
William's
Smith
Newton
O'Connor
Farrell
Farrell
O'loughlin

Notable mentions who only just missed out not picked by Jonny or me.
Hansen
Charnley
Mickey Mac
Tommy leuluai
Bateman

Re: 1-13 at the DW : Thu Sep 12, 2019 9:31 pm  
Late to the party so one does apologies;

1. Radlinski
2. Dallas
3. Renouf
4. Gleeson
5. Richards
6. Barrett
7. Lam
8. Craig Smith
9. Newton
10. Pongia
11. L Farrell
12. A Farrell
13. O’Loughlin

Rads over Tomkins purely because of what he did for us in 2006. Genuinely no other reason, it just shows what type of man Rads was in that he’d bleed cherry and white. I’m not convinced Tomkins was ever the same.

Choosing between Gleason and Carmont was a very tough choice too. I couldn’t actually give a reason why I went for Gleeson because I liked him as a player as much as I did Carmont.
